A Hitachi Vantara Case Study
DZ Bank, the central institution for more than 900 cooperative banks and ~12,000 branch offices and one of Germany’s largest banks by assets, faced rapidly growing data volumes and needed a more flexible, transparent cost model — shifting from capex to opex. To meet this challenge the bank partnered with Hitachi Vantara to design a capacity-on-demand solution, deploying Hitachi Virtual Storage Platform systems with Hitachi Accelerated Flash and tiering/software services to support a modern, manageable storage architecture.
Hitachi Vantara implemented a customized capacity-on-demand model with two mirrored VSP systems and gold/silver/bronze storage pools, billing based on measured consumption (monthly measurements aggregated into a six-month midyear value) and a five‑year operating agreement. The solution gave DZ Bank predictable opex billing, easier self-management of pools, monthly capacity tests and quarterly planning reviews, and proved resilient to sudden growth (an 18‑month re-integration of systems was handled through renegotiation), delivering greater cost transparency, control and planning certainty.
